AI Summary

  • Repeals and replaces sections 8.683 and 8.685 of Missouri Revised Statutes regarding construction management services contracts for public owners.

  • Permits construction managers to bid on and perform actual construction work on public works projects, reversing the prior prohibition on such dual roles.

  • Allows construction firms that control, are controlled by, or share common ownership with the construction manager to bid on and perform work on the same project.

  • Enables construction management services contracts to be awarded on a negotiated basis even when the construction manager guarantees, warrants, or assumes financial responsibility for other contractors' work or provides guaranteed maximum prices.

  • Requires all bidders to contract directly with the public owner or construction manager, provide payment and performance bonds, meet prevailing wage obligations, and comply with nonresident employer bonding and registration requirements.

Legislative Description

Allows a construction manager and any construction firm that he or she controls to bid and perform any of the actual construction on a public works project
